ASPECTS ON RESIDUAL BIOMASS TO GAS FUEL CONVERSION USING AIR AS OXIDIZER

This paper presents the experimental results and process analysis of residual food waste air gasification. The experiments were conducted on a batch tubular reactor at laboratory scale, using air at atmospheric pressure as oxidizer. Temperature and equivalent ratio (ER) were varied to assess the optimum process parameters for this particular type of biomass. The temperature was varied between 650 degrees C and 850 degrees C, and the ER between 0.25 and 0.35. The process performance was evaluated in terms of syngas specific energy content, carbon conversion efficiency and cold/hot-gas efficiency.
